Is it worth repairing an old appliance in Albany, New York, or should I replace it?
It depends on the age of the appliance, the cost of the repair, and its overall condition. In Albany, a professional appliance repair technician can assess the issue and provide an estimate. If the repair cost is less than 50% of the replacement cost and the appliance is relatively new, repairing is often worthwhile.

What is the average cost to repair a refrigerator or washer in Albany, New York?
Repair costs vary based on the appliance type, part needed, and service provider. In Albany, typical repair costs for major appliances can range from $100 to $300, but get a detailed quote from a licensed professional before proceeding.
